Another interesting question is whether he retained the appointment as Befelshaber Wehrkreis I on the formation of AOK 3.

char. Generalmajor Oskar von Beneckendorff und von Hindenburg is shown by Keilig as mdWdGb Wehrkreis I and as Vertreter in Die Generale des Heeres.

Also the appointments list that announces his appointment as OB AOK 18 states: "General der Artillerie von Küchler, OB Grenz.Absch.Nord und Befehlshaber i. Wehrkreis I ist mit dem 5. Nov. 1939, z. OB 18. Armee ernannt".

Again, the Dienstlaufbahn is of no help.

Apart from the Dienstlaufbahn, are there any other documents that could give some indication when Küchler's role as Inspector of War Schools ceased?

Was it 02.10.1936 when he was appointed Deputy President of the Reich War Court or on 01.04.1937 when made Commanding General of I. Armee-Korps? 01.04.1937 would probably make more sense but if it can be confirmed that would be great.
